![]() |
|
|
|
|
Change By:
|
Grégory Joseph
(23/Oct/14 3:29 PM)
|
|
Description:
|
We're finally moving to Maven 3.x Maven 3.2.3 fixes a bunch of issues we've had in the past: - various
(
quick temp description
plugins, poms) inheritance related issues - performance,
to
gather info before doing anything
a certain extent - scope:import can be simplified !
It is also needed for Nexus staging (BUILD-151
)
Stuff
We'll need
to
take into account
*
adapt our
parent poms
and site generation (see BUILD-19, BUILD-29, BUILD-148 and BUILD-135)
*
check a bunch of
plugins
** in
, n
particular the release plugin ! *
generated sites - http://maven.apache.org/plugins/maven-site-plugin/maven-3.html ** See BUILD-135 *
check
archetypes *
doc
Settings -
Maven
settings
download from Nexus as documented
: updated wiki
at
http
https
://
documentation
wiki
.magnolia-cms.com/display/
DOCS
DEVINT
/Maven+
init don
tips#Maventips-Settingsxml, we
'
t work; but this newer version of the plugin doesn't seem
ll need
to
work with Maven 3.1 either
update https
:
{noformat} mvn org.sonatype.plugins:nexus-m2settings-maven-plugin:1.4.6:download -DnexusUrl=http:
//
nexus
documentation
.magnolia-cms.com
-DtemplateId=magnolia-community-public -Dsecure=false
/display/DOCS/Maven+init
{noformat}
(however it's probably what we'll need when we upgrade Nexus)
Most important changes from Maven 2 are documented at
https://cwiki.apache.org/confluence/display/MAVEN/Maven+3.x+Compatibility+Notes
|
|
|
|
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ators
For more information on JIRA, see: http://www.atlassian.com/software/jira
|
----------------------------------------------------------------
For list details, see: http://www.magnolia-cms.com/community/mailing-lists.html
Alternatively, use our forums: http://forum.magnolia-cms.com/
To unsubscribe, E-mail to: <
[email protected]>
----------------------------------------------------------------